Abstract

A telescopic device for a cake turntable includes an inner tube and an outer tube. The inner tube has L-shaped grooves on both its front and rear sides, a retaining ring at the bottom, and a bearing stop inside. A fixing ring is located inside the upper part of the outer tube, with keyways on both its front and rear sides. A fixing tube and a fixing cap are located at the bottom of the outer tube. The L-shaped grooves consist of straight and horizontal grooves, with the horizontal groove at the bottom of the straight groove. The inner tube is placed inside the outer tube to form a telescopic rod. Rotating the inner tube clockwise connects the keyways with the horizontal grooves, extending the telescopic rod and fixing its height. Rotating the inner tube counterclockwise connects the keyways with the straight grooves, retracting it to its original height.

Description

Technical Field

[0001] This utility model relates to an accessory, particularly suitable for a telescopic device on a cake turntable. Background Technology

[0002] With social progress, economic prosperity, and improved living standards, the sales of cake turntable products have continued to grow and are exported all over the world. Currently, the telescopic structure of cake turntables is generally composed of a combination of latches and pins, which has the problem that the pins can easily pinch fingers during use. Summary of the Invention

[0003] To overcome the above-mentioned shortcomings, this utility model provides a telescopic device for a cake turntable. In order to reduce the size, the original rotating rod is changed to a telescopic rod. In order to facilitate telescopic movement and reduce costs, the original telescopic rod with a combination of lock and ball is directly changed to a telescopic rod with an "L"-shaped buckle and key combination. In order to ensure that the telescopic rod does not detach, a fixing ring is provided on the upper part of the outer tube and a retaining ring is provided on the inner tube. It has the characteristics of simple structure, convenient operation, safety and firmness.

[0004] The technical solution adopted by this utility model to solve its technical problem is: a telescopic device on a cake turntable, including an inner tube and an outer tube. The inner tube is provided with an "L"-shaped buckle groove on both the front and back sides, and a retaining ring is provided at the bottom. A bearing stop is provided inside the inner tube. A fixing ring is provided inside the upper part of the outer tube. The fixing ring is provided with groove keys on both the front and back sides. A fixing tube and a fixing cover are provided at the bottom of the outer tube. The "L"-shaped buckle groove is composed of a straight groove and a horizontal groove, and the horizontal groove is located at the bottom of the straight groove. The inner tube is located inside the outer tube to form a telescopic rod.

[0005] Furthermore, rotating the inner tube clockwise connects the keyway to the transverse groove, thus extending the telescopic rod and fixing its height.

[0006] Going a step further, rotate the inner tube counterclockwise, and the keyway connects with the straight groove, thus retracting it to its original height.

[0007] The slot key is located in the latching groove to serve as a positioning and extension mechanism.

[0008] The fixing ring on the outer tube contacts the retaining ring on the inner tube to prevent the inner tube from separating from the outer tube.

[0017] exist Figures 1-3 In a cake turntable, a telescopic device is provided, comprising an inner tube 1 and an outer tube 2. The inner tube has an "L"-shaped groove 3 milled on both the front and back sides, a retaining ring 9 machined at the bottom, a bearing retainer machined inside the inner tube, and a fixing ring 10 machined inside the upper part of the outer tube. The fixing ring has grooves and keys 11 milled on both the front and back sides. The lower part of the outer tube is connected to a fixing tube 6 and a fixing cover 5. The "L"-shaped groove is composed of a straight groove 7 and a horizontal groove 8, and the bottom of the horizontal groove is connected to the bottom of the straight groove. The inner tube is installed inside the outer tube to form a telescopic rod 4.

[0018] Furthermore, rotate the inner tube clockwise once, and the keyway connects with the transverse groove, thus extending the telescopic rod and fixing its height.

[0019] Going a step further, rotate the inner tube counterclockwise, and the keyway connects with the straight groove, thus retracting it to its original height.

[0020] exist Figure 4 In the middle, the inner tube at the upper part of the telescopic rod 4 is connected to the bearing on the turntable 12, the fixed tube at the lower part of the outer tube of the telescopic rod is connected to the fixed plate 13, and the fixed cover is installed on the fixed plate, thus forming a cake turntable.

[0021] exist Figure 5 In the original locking pin telescopic rod 14, a locking buckle 16 and a pin 17 are installed, with a gap 15 left on the locking buckle.
